Identifying Liability in Malfunctioning Ski Equipment Cases

When it comes to ski equipment malfunctions, identifying liability can be a complex process. In cases where a skier is injured due to faulty equipment, multiple parties may potentially be held liable, including the ski resort, the equipment manufacturer, and the rental shop. Determining who is at fault requires a detailed investigation into the circumstances of the accident.

One key factor in establishing liability is whether the malfunction was due to a defect in the equipment itself or negligent maintenance by the rental shop. If the gear was improperly maintained or not inspected for safety, the rental shop could be held accountable for the injuries sustained by the skier. On the other hand, if the equipment was inherently flawed and caused the accident, the manufacturer may bear the responsibility for compensation. Factors Influencing Liability

In addition to the condition of the equipment, other factors may influence liability in ski equipment malfunction cases. Weather conditions, the skier's level of experience, and any warning signs posted by the ski resort can all play a role in determining who is responsible for the accident. It's essential to gather as much evidence as possible, such as witness statements, ski patrol reports, and photographs of the faulty equipment, to support your case.

Moreover, understanding the legal standards and regulations surrounding ski equipment safety is crucial in identifying liability. Common Types of Injuries from Faulty Ski Equipment

Skiing is an exhilarating sport enjoyed by many, but sadly, accidents can happen, especially when equipment malfunctions. When ski equipment is defective or improperly maintained, it can lead to a variety of injuries. One common type of injury is fractures or broken bones, which can occur when bindings fail to release or when skis do not respond as expected. These injuries can be painful and require extensive medical treatment.

Another common injury from faulty ski equipment is head trauma. When helmets are not properly designed or fail to protect the head upon impact, skiers can suffer from concussions or more severe head injuries. These types of injuries can have long-lasting effects on a person's quality of life and may require ongoing medical care. Additionally, soft tissue injuries like sprains, strains, or torn ligaments can also result from defective ski equipment. Such injuries can be painful and debilitating, affecting a skier's ability to enjoy the sport they love.

Steps to Take After a Ski Equipment Injury

If you have been injured due to malfunctioning ski equipment while enjoying the slopes in Sun Valley, ID, it is crucial to take specific steps to protect your well-being and legal rights. The first step after sustaining an injury is to seek medical attention immediately. Even if you feel that your injuries are minor, it is essential to have a healthcare professional evaluate your condition to prevent any underlying issues from worsening over time. Documenting your injuries through medical records is also crucial for any potential legal claims in the future.

After seeking medical help, it is important to report the incident to the ski resort or rental shop where the malfunctioning equipment was provided. Ensure that a written incident report is filed and request a copy for your records. This documentation can be valuable when determining liability in your case. Additionally, gather as much evidence as possible, such as witness statements, photographs of the equipment, and the location where the accident occurred. These pieces of evidence can help strengthen your potential claim for compensation for your injuries.
